Output e913d7b1aa3ed557d3a3ae918fb441bf152e12f49e1cc4010ec82dc44bf96363:24

value
75800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bfdb519924056924838c99e29da9df51ec7a145 OP_EQUAL
address
34F26d8u9MxLUncDk89Ea82x3KpCqMeSb8
transaction
e913d7b1aa3ed557d3a3ae918fb441bf152e12f49e1cc4010ec82dc44bf96363
confirmations
201091
spent
true